Overview

About the Role FTI Consulting is building a strong EMEA Leadership team to drive the growth and transformation of the region and looking for top performers at various levels to join the team. This role directly supports the Chairman, COO, CSO, Head of Markets and other members of senior leadership within FTI's corporate infrastructure on a number of strategic and change initiatives across the company. What You'll Do Overall project management for cross functional/ high impact/ high profile projects, working across and within teams, developing options and solutions and creating materials for discussion/ stakeholder management/ action Proactively lead the development of solutions to problems through management consultations, data analysis, team meetings, and other applicable strategies Leading and influencing change through supporting the wider business to learn and apply new skills, processes and adopt change (ultimately connected to improving efficiency and effectiveness) Clearly summarize gathered data and facts, confidently communicate/present findings to members of senior management as needed, develop action plans with clear accountability, PMO change efforts to improve the business Strive for high-quality deliverables; drive projects to achieve maximum impact for the team and the firm Understand how his/her own work fits into the broader business context Some travel (10-20%) to other FTI offices as needed How You'll Grow This is a great opportunity for a proactive, confident, articulate, creative consulting professional to be part of FTI growth in EMEA and to collaborate and lead our business development and transformation plans. The Business Transformation Manager will have the opportunity to partner with our senior leaders in EMEA on a wide variety of initiatives related to business growth, strategic operational decisions and performance improvement projects. Basic Qualifications and Skills Accountant or CFA or MBA/ Management Consulting training (essential) and Degree level education Relevant experience of running strategic projects in complex environments and influencing at senior management level Has a high tolerance for ambiguity; deals well with unexpected or adverse situations and works well under pressure Ability to express and present own opinion and be persuasive in achieving company's objectives Strong Microsoft Office skills, especially Excel and PowerPoint (essential) Experience with ThinkCell and Tableau (desirable) Excellent interpersonal skills, including collaborative work style, problems solving and conceptual thinking skills Creative in conveying ideas and data on the page with a proactive approach to solving/completing assigned tasks Strong leadership skills - Works well with others across and up, down and across the organization Our Benefits Apart from the well-structured career path and excellent team environment, our employees enjoy a variety of perks and benefits.
